英文摘要
The impairment of pineal function with age results in insufficient
secretion of the hormone melatonin from this gland. Thus, the
administration of melatonin to the elderly has been considered as a
treatment for the aging-associated loss of circadian rhythms. Or for
neuroendocrine and immune imbalances. The lack of melatonin and its
antioxidative activity in the elderly might be important in the
pathophysiology of aging-associated neurodegenerative brain disorders.
Melatonin may influence the receptors for the inhibitory neurotransmitter
gamma aminobutyric acid (GABA); the expression of these receptors is
affected by aging. We and others have shown that melatonin protects
against neurotoxic effects of the excitatory neurotransmitter glutamate,
in particular when kainate-sensitive glutamate receptors are stimulated.
We found that administration of melatonin to rats attenuates kainate-
induced brain damage, and that greater damage occurs after kainate in old
adult animals. This damage is also greater in pinealectomized than in
sham-operated rats. In addition, we found that pinealectomy decreases the
expression of mRNA for the alpha1 subunit of the GABAA receptor complex.
Others have reported a decreased expression of alpha1 receptor subunit
mRNA in old rats. We hypothesize that the melatonin deficiency that
occurs with aging is responsible for changes in the expression of GABAA
receptor subunits, increased neurotoxic kainate excitotoxicity, and for a
changed antiexcitotoxic efficacy of benzodiazepines (BZDs). We propose
the following AIMs: AIM 1: testing the hypothesis that aging and
pinealectomy (PIN-X) similarly potentiate kainate-triggered hippocampal
damage, and that administration of exogenous melatonin is neuroprotective
both in old and PIN-X rats; AIM 2: testing the hypothesis that aging and
PIN-X similarly affect the content of GABA receptor subunits mRNAs in the
rat brain and that the effect of PIN-X can be reversed by melatonin; AIM
3: Testing the hypothesis that the anticonvulsive/neuroprotective action
of BZDs against kainate is similarly affected by aging and pinalectory.
The project proposed is a logical extension of our previous work into the
area of aging. The results we will obtain might help to direct treatment
strategies for neurodegenerative diseases associated with aging toward the
aging component of these disorders, rather than at disease-specific
mechanisms.
